The Kitten

I was out walking when I heard a sound,
I followed it and you'll never guess what I found,
A gray and white kitty,
With soft blue eyes looking up at me,
I reached out to pet it's fluffy coat,
When a male voice from behind me spoke,
"She's a stray!"
I couldn't imagine her living that way!
"Take her, she's free,
A good home she will need."
I picked up the kitten in my arms,
Promising to take care of her so she wouldn't be harmed.

I took her back to my house,
Gave her some milk and she even found a mouse,
But she didn't look well as the day went by,
So I took her to the vet to see.
He smiled, then said to me,
"This cat will soon have babies!"
Soon after I was the proud owner of four kittens instead of one,
The man had said to give the kitten a home and that's exactly what I'd done!
